Section Manager in the Department of Natural Resources overseeing design and construction in the Office of Water Resources. Ensuring effective management and implementation of engineering policies and projects.

About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Directs the structural geotechnical and general civil design and preparation of contract plans for dams, bridges, culverts, pump stations, spillways, reservoirs and all earth steel concrete and timber structures on Water Resource projects.
  • Directs the management of ongoing construction projects.
  • Serves as a full-line supervisor.
  • Approves signs and places Professional Engineering seal on all Division designed plans and specifications.
  • Develops and implements policies and procedures and formulates applicable design specifications and criteria for all design projects.
  • Directs and coordinates the soils investigation program through contracts with Consultants.
  • Develops working relations with OWR employees and other Departmental and non-Departmental contacts.
  • Performs other duties as required or assigned which are reasonably within the scope of work of the duties enumerated above.

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Requires knowledge skill and mental development equivalent to completion of four years of college with a degree in civil engineering.
  • Requires prior experience equivalent to four years of progressively responsible engineering management experience.
  • Requires Professional Engineering License in the State of Illinois.
  • Four (4) years or more experience in the field of civil and/or structural engineering (preferred).
  • Three (3) years experience of on-site management construction projects (preferred).
  • Professional working knowledge of coordinating pre bid and preconstruction contract plans (preferred).
  • Three (3) years of experience of on-site project experience overseeing various contractors (preferred).
  • Three (3) years of experience in preparing of contract plans, including dams, bridges, culverts, pump stations, spillways, reservoirs relating to earth construction (preferred).
  • Two (2) years of supervisory experience (preferred).
